About Apton Hall
Apton Hall is an emerging vineyard nestled in the scenic Essex countryside within the East Anglia region of England. Located near Canvey Island, this boutique winery represents the exciting growth of English wine production in one of the country's most promising wine-growing counties. Established in 2024, Apton Hall is a newcomer to the English wine scene, yet it has already established itself as a destination for wine enthusiasts seeking authentic vineyard experiences in Essex.
The vineyard currently cultivates approximately 0.40 hectares of vines, planted exclusively with Pinot Noir. This classic grape variety is renowned for producing both still red wines and increasingly popular English rosé wines. The cool climate of East Anglia, with its maritime influences and well-drained soils, provides suitable conditions for growing Pinot Noir, allowing the vineyard to craft wines that reflect the unique terroir of this part of England.
